WebIn concrete terms, Six Sigma means that the company's processes maintain six standard deviations from the mean value of the process to the nearest tolerance limit. It follows from this that Cpk 2.0 gives 6 sigma, while for … WebMay 13, 2024 · In general, the higher the Cpk, the better. A Cpk value less than 1.0 is considered poor and the process is not capable. A value between 1.0 and 1.33 is considered barely capable, and a value greater than 1.33 is considered capable. But, you should aim for a Cpk value of 2.00 or higher where possible. WebNov 17, 2024 · In this case, we can see from the formula for Cp that 6-Sigma corresponds to Cpk 2.0, 4-Sigma corresponds to Cpk 1.33, and 3-Sigma corresponds to Cpk 1.0. Note again, however, that the critical factors affecting Cpk are the limits and the standard deviation of the process. WebNote that Cp = Cpk = 1.33. The sigma level is now 4 – the specification limits are now four standard deviations away from the average. The out of specification has decreased from …

WebFeb 26, 2010 · In the Six Sigma quality methodology, process performance is reported to the organization as a sigma level. The higher the sigma level, the better the process is performing. Another way to report process capability and process performance is through the statistical measurements of C p, C pk, P p, and P pk.

WebTo satisfy most customers, we generally want a Cpk of at least 1.33 [4 sigmas] or higher. Cpk can have an upper and lower value reported.
